What Holland Casino Actually Is

Holland Casino Online is not a generic offshore casino brand. It is the digital platform of Holland Casino N.V., a public limited company owned by the government of the Netherlands. That ownership model matters because it changes the incentive structure. Instead of behaving like a fast-moving private affiliate brand, the operator sits closer to a public-interest framework, with profits returning to the Dutch treasury and licensing oversight coming from the Netherlands Gambling Authority, also known as the KSA.

For beginners, that usually translates into a more controlled environment. The upside is tighter compliance, stronger verification, and clearer rules around account creation and responsible gambling. The downside is less flexibility. A state-owned operator is not trying to win customers from everywhere; it is serving a narrow, regulated audience and enforcing that boundary hard.

Licensing, Safety, and Reputation

From a reputation standpoint, Holland Casino scores well on structural credibility. The operator holds a single iGaming licence from the KSA, and that regulator is known for strict supervision rather than loose market access. That matters because a license is only as useful as the enforcement behind it.

There is also a notable regulatory detail: the KSA publicly warned the operator in late 2023 about ongoing issues with its Control Database, the reporting system used for oversight. That does not automatically make the casino unsafe, but it does show that regulation is active and not merely symbolic. For an analyst, this is a positive sign in one sense: the operator is being monitored. For a player, it is a reminder that even strong brands can have operational friction.

On the security side, the platform uses SSL encryption and Playtech infrastructure. That suggests a serious technical base rather than a lightweight white-label setup. How KYC and Responsible Gambling Work Here

Holland Casino’s onboarding is intentionally strict. Verification is mandatory, and the process is linked to Dutch identity and residency checks. The platform also connects to CRUKS, the Netherlands’ central self-exclusion register. In practice, that means the operator is built to reject the wrong user profile early, not after account creation.

That approach has two implications. First, it protects the market from fraud and underage access. Second, it creates a smoother legal environment for the operator but a much narrower doorway for players. If you are a beginner used to faster offshore signups, this may feel inconvenient. In reality, it is part of the compliance model.
